Report:
The best laid plans! So a fine morning after heavy rain overnight somewhat scuppered our plans ; as we headed out to Denchworth we rode through some large puddles before getting to the bridge. At which point we were advised that the floods ahead were too deep :(. we discussed going along the main road but decided that the route back would be a problem and so we decided on an alternative short route to Ardington via Laines Barn. Roger who was suffering with back pain returned to Grove, and Des David and myself rode on. The road to Laines barn had some flooding but having observed traffic passing we carried on. We did a circle around Ardington and came back into Wantage using the cycle path on the outskirts of the Kingsgrove estate. Coffee in Marmalade was lovely after which we rode back to Grove. A measley 12 miles but good company and great to be out in the fresh air.

Categories
1* - Suitable for irregular, social, beginner or family riders, pace will match the slower riders. Not hilly or long. Expect rides up to 3 hours. Gentle exercise.
2* - Suitable for regular riders who prefer to cover some distance but at a more relaxed pace. Likely to be half-day rides. Solid exercise.
3* - Suitable for experienced riders, may be hilly, long, quick, or any combination! Likely to be half or full-day rides. Challenging exercise.
4* - Suitable for athletic riders who can ride safely above the 3* standard. Quick rides for the fit.
